Teach, Learn, Share
Berlin -> Get yourself a bike. Mind the dog shit.
Barcelona -> Beware of the charming Argentines. Raval is colourful, central, cheap and tourist free.
Strasbourg -> Go to the top of the Cathedral. La Laiterie good live music venue. Explore outside the medieval centre.
